Unfortunately most care information about these beetles is not the best but they're not hard to care for. Just make sure they have burrowable substrate (not just sand), keep them on a low sugar diet and keep them a little above room temp and they will be a lot happier than in a box of sand lol

You actually were a huge inspiration for me, I didn't have the time or capacity to care for any herps back then despite obsessing over your vids and the bioactive movement, i picked some up for myself! Going on nearly 4 years now. They're amazing, easier than almost anything to keep and as entertaining as a fish tank I watch them (embarrassingly) for hours lol! I've got them in a 75gal, with a few other desert beetle species, a large harvestman as well as 2 sonoran, and 2 texan millipedes. The Sonora, Mojave, baja and Chihuahuan deserts host some of the coolest plants, its been a long process but I've mostly got a biotope going on and I learned almost everything entirely from you!
